    What is a Portable Monitor?

    A portable monitor is a compact and lightweight display device that can be easily connected to electronic devices such as laptops, tablets, smartphones, and game consoles. It serves as an additional screen, offering users a larger display area and enhanced visual experience. Portable monitors are an easy way to extend a laptop screen or increase the display size for a mobile device.

    Drawbacks of Portable Monitors

    Portable monitors and traditional monitors have their own advantages and disadvantages, and you can understand and consider whether you can accept the shortcomings of portable screens before you buy them.

    1. Lower resolution and pixel density compared to desktop monitors: Desktop monitors typically offer higher resolutions, often ranging from Full High Definition (FHD) at 1920 x 1080 pixels to 4K at 3840 x 2160 pixels. In contrast, portable monitors often have lower resolutions, such as HD at 1280 x 720 pixels or FHD at 1920 x 1080 pixels, due to their smaller size and power constraints.
    2. Generally more expensive than regular monitors: The higher cost is primarily due to the compact design, portability, and advanced features such as USB-C connectivity and touchscreens. This increased cost may deter some users from investing in a portable monitor.
    3. May have design limitations (e.g., limited adjustability): Portable monitors often have smaller screens, which can limit the amount of content that can be displayed simultaneously. Additionally, they may lack certain features such as HDMI ports, which can limit their connectivity options.

    Portable Monitor vs. Tablet: Which is Better?

    When comparing portable monitors and tablets, it's essential to consider their features, price, and use cases:

    • Features: Portable monitors are designed to provide an additional display for laptops or desktops, enhancing productivity and multitasking capabilities. They typically offer higher resolutions, larger display sizes, and better color accuracy compared to tablets. On the other hand, tablets are standalone devices with touchscreens and often come with more comprehensive features such as cameras, GPS, and cellular connectivity.
    • Price: Portable monitors tend to be more affordable, with options like the AOC e1659Fwux starting at around $150. High-end portable monitors, such as the ASUS ZenScreen MB16AC, can cost upwards of $250. Tablets, particularly those from well-known brands like Apple, can be significantly more expensive, with the Apple iPad Pro starting at around $800 for the base model.
    • Use cases: Portable monitors are ideal for scenarios where an additional display is needed, such as multitasking, gaming, and presentations. Tablets, on the other hand, are better suited for portability, touchscreen interaction, and content consumption.

      What to Look for When Buying a Portable Monitor

      1. Resolution and display quality: A higher resolution, such as Full HD (1080p) or 4K, will provide a clearer and more detailed image. Display quality is also impacted by factors such as the panel type (e.g., IPS, TN, or OLED) and the monitor's ability to accurately reproduce colors.
      2. Connectivity options (wireless, USB, HDMI): Portable monitors often come with a variety of ports, including USB-A, USB-C, HDMI, and DisplayPort. The type and number of ports required will depend on the devices you plan to connect to the monitor.
      3. Size and weight: Smaller and lighter monitors are more convenient for travel, but may compromise on screen size and resolution. Larger monitors may offer better display quality but may be heavier and less portable.
      4. Battery life (if applicable): Look for monitors with long battery life, often measured in hours, to ensure continuous use without needing to recharge. Some portable monitors can last up to 10 hours on a single charge.
      5. Price and value for money: The price of a portable monitor varies greatly depending on the specifications and features. Budget-friendly options may start at around $200, while high-end models with advanced features can cost upwards of $1,000.

      FAQs

      Are portable monitors suitable for gaming?

      Yes, many portable monitors are suitable for gaming. Look for models with high refresh rates (e.g., 144Hz or more), low response times (preferably under 5ms), and support for technologies like AMD FreeSync or NVIDIA G - Sync. These features ensure smooth gameplay, reduce motion blur, and prevent screen tearing. For example, some Arzopa portable monitors are designed with high refresh rates, making them great for fast - paced games.

      Can I use a portable monitor with my smartphone?

      If your smartphone supports DisplayPort Alt Mode via USB - C, you can connect it to a portable monitor with a USB - C input. This allows you to use your phone as a mobile workstation or enjoy games and videos on a larger screen. Some smartphones also support wireless display options, and if your portable monitor has a corresponding wireless receiver, you can connect them wirelessly.

      Can I use a portable monitor as a second screen for my laptop when working?

      Absolutely. Connecting a portable monitor to your laptop can significantly increase your productivity. You can have your main work application on one screen and reference materials, emails, or chat windows on the other. This is especially useful for tasks like content creation, data analysis, and programming. All you need is a compatible connection, such as USB - C or HDMI, depending on your laptop and the monitor's ports.
